## Further Reading

Currency conversion in Ledgervane rounds at the final aggregation step, never per line item, to keep totals reconcilable across reports. Before cutting a release, verify no new code introduces intermediate rounding — past regressions came from exactly that. The full rationale, worked examples, and the sign-off checklist are maintained on the internal page below.

runbook for badug-kadup: https://confluence.zemvarlabs.internal/projects/browse/display/projects/bd1b

EXIF Scrubbing — Review Step 4. Before any user-uploaded image reaches the Larkspur CDN tier, the scrubber strips all EXIF blocks, including GPS, serial numbers, and embedded thumbnails. Verify the scrub by re-reading the file post-write, not by trusting the library return code; we have seen silent failures on malformed TIFF headers. Sample payloads and the full verification checklist are maintained on the internal page below.

wiki page, tahaf-tajog: https://jira.ordindyn.corp/pipeline

## Releases

Welcome aboard! ChipScout — our marathon timing-chip reader firmware — gets a release whenever the Tarnwell race calendar demands it, usually monthly. Builds come out of the Lappetree CI runner, get signed automatically, and land in the firmware bucket. Never flash a reader with an unsigned image; the mats at the start line will refuse it anyway. To verify a build locally before a race weekend, run the checker script and compare against the release key below.

deploy key for kahof-tadup: bky4_rRMZ

Subject: Quickstore 4.2 — bloom filter now fronts the KV layer

Plugin authors: starting with this release, Quickstore places a bloom filter ahead of the key-value store. Negative lookups return faster; false positives fall through safely. No API changes are required on your side. Verify your plugin against the staging build referenced below.

session token of fahif-tadup = htk3_9c7